Cum să-ți asiguri structura și ordinea ca dezvoltator
Odată ce era ușor să pierzi rapid din vedere în programare: a fost schimbat un fișier aici, unul nou a fost adăugat acolo, altul a dispărut... Astfel, lucruri importante au fost ușor uitate de pe drumul de la versiunea X la versiunea Y. Git vine în ajutor.
Cu sistemul de control al versiunilor liber disponibil de la Linus Torvalds, creatorul Linux-ului, îți poți transforma haosul de date în opusul său și poți crea istorii clare și rapide pentru programele tale. În această instruire de 1,5 ore și 13 lecții vei afla totul despre Git și vei învăța cum să aplici gestiunea.
Pentru a nu te arunca în apă rece, în primul tutorial video vei fi instruit în detaliu în toate aspectele esențiale legate de conceptele de bază ale lui Git și GitHub: Cum funcționa controlul versiunilor înainte de astfel de instrumente de gestiune, care sunt avantajele utilizării Git-ului și care este diferența față de GitHub? Trainerul îți va da răspunsuri precise la aceste întrebări utilizând diagrame structurale sugestive și liste de fapte.
Pentru a-ți ușura înțelegerea conținutului cursului, vei învăța apoi cum să utilizezi Git atât pe macOS, cât și pe Windows. Ulterior, vei trece direct la practică și vei învăța să creezi repozitoare (adică "depozite" pentru datele tale).
Partea principală a cursului se ocupă în cele din urmă cu modificările efectuate asupra liniilor tale de cod: Vei învăța cum să le înregistrezi, să le vizualizezi, să le salvezi, să le verifici în istoric și - un aspect extrem de important pentru munca ta zilnică - să le revoci dacă este necesar. La final, Jan Brinkmann îți va arăta cum să folosești furnizori de servicii de găzduire cum ar fi GitHub sau Bitbucket pentru a-ți publica proiectele.
Ce îți va aduce acest curs?
Vei învăța sistemul de control al versiunilor Git, cel mai probabil cel mai important și liber disponibil, și cum să-l folosești. Astfel, vei avea mereu control asupra tuturor modificărilor din proiectele tale de software. Structură și ordine, pe care orice dezvoltator cu simțul profesionalismului ar trebui să le aibă în inimă. Status, gitignore, commit, diff?! - După curs, vei avea toți parametrii importanți pentru utilizarea Git-ului în repertoriul tău de programare!